A training and technology firm in the UK is seeking candidates for a role in smart technology within the electrical sector. This position involves assisting in the setup and maintenance of smart electrical systems, learning how technology enhances energy efficiency.
No prior experience is required; a practical mindset, attention to detail, and a team-oriented attitude are essential. Ideal for those interested in smart devices and emerging technologies.

How to prepare for a job interview at Back to Work Training Limited
✨Know Your Smart Tech
Familiarise yourself with the latest trends in smart electrical systems. Research how these technologies improve energy efficiency and be ready to discuss your thoughts on them. This shows your genuine interest in the field and can spark engaging conversations during the interview.
✨Showcase Your Practical Mindset
Since this role values a practical mindset, think of examples from your past experiences where you've solved problems or worked on hands-on projects. Even if you haven't worked in this sector before, any relevant experience can demonstrate your ability to learn and adapt quickly.
✨Emphasise Teamwork
This position requires a team-oriented attitude, so be prepared to share examples of how you've successfully collaborated with others. Highlighting your ability to work well in a team will show that you're a good fit for their company culture.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ions about the company's approach to smart technology and their training programmes. This not only shows your enthusiasm for the role but also helps you gauge if the company aligns with your career goals.
